Transaction 5e28954b7310b93fe7925733b72b8015128251a0810afffabd9b50a7787c30e6
1 Input
1 Output
-
5e28954b7310b93fe7925733b72b8015128251a0810afffabd9b50a7787c30e6:0
- value
- 5326786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7667ac76f5c8cc041624bfb97f3557a9d6054eee OP_EQUAL
- address
- 3CV5rZ5yqFt2iPwSLxPPdBGayQdTUKhbon